21 lines
623 B
HTML
21 lines
623 B
HTML
<!DOCTYPE html>
|
|
<meta charset="utf-8" >
|
|
<meta name="author" title="Di Zhang" href="mailto:dizhangg@chromium.org">
|
|
<meta name="assert" content="Remove slot with assigned node, when dynamically created.">
|
|
<title>Shadow DOM: Slots and fallback contents</title>
|
|
<link rel="match" href="slot-fallback-content-005-ref.html">
|
|
|
|
<p>Test passes if empty.</p>
|
|
|
|
<div id="host">
|
|
<slot id="slot1" name="slot1">FAIL</slot>
|
|
<div id="A" slot="slot1">FAIL</div>
|
|
</div>
|
|
|
|
<script>
|
|
const shadowRoot = host.attachShadow({ mode: "open" });
|
|
shadowRoot.appendChild(slot1);
|
|
const s1 = shadowRoot.getElementById('slot1');
|
|
s1.remove();
|
|
|
|
</script>
|